Question:should i prepare a dialouge,beauty tips, anything??


Best Answer - Chosen by Asker: should i prepare a dialouge,beauty tips, anything??

Ok, so ive been acting all my life, so my advice to you is; dress up-scale casual basically, a nice pair of dress pants and a really nice shirt but age appropriate, makeup; as natural as possible, brown eyeliner and mascara, not too much foundation or blush make it natural and age appropriate too; have a monolauge preped but they are most likely to give you something when you get there. that's the best advice i have to give you.

Okay, now I haven't acted or anything, but I doubt makeup will really help. If you have the talent and act like you ARE your character, they can take care of the makeup. So I would work on body pose, dialog, voice tones, facial expressions, anything that would make your character become real.
